Transaction ee788ed59f9f66f9c56ae046b1f8fc8807a725b77f0a73a41bb4d2fc4857b782
1 Input
1 Output
-
ee788ed59f9f66f9c56ae046b1f8fc8807a725b77f0a73a41bb4d2fc4857b782:0
- value
- 13277966
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e500c8ed6b9bb998375e629b4c40f0ff8f403f18 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MsrgTroakTZkY61k62h5GHLbuhhYKh8ry